Just look at Gregg Popovich for example with the San Antonio Spurs! Coach Pop has been with the Spurs organization since 1988 and has been their head coach since he took over for Bob Hill during the 1996-97 season. 

Since then, Popovich has posted a 1308-644 record with the Spurs, including this year, and has coached them to 5 championships! He may have had great players in Tim Duncan, Tony Parker and Manu Ginobili, but Gregg Popovich is one heck of a coach and is still one of the greatest coaches in the league today!
